Planning Application for New Holmfirth Retirement Development Approved

Planning Application for New Holmfirth Retirement Development Approved
 

Award-winning Holmfirth property developer Conroy Brook (Developments) Ltd is delighted to announce that its planning application for a new retirement complex, on the brownfield Prickleden Mill site in Holmfirth, has been approved by Kirklees Council, at the 23 August Planning Sub-Committee meeting.


The proposals envisage transforming the now disused industrial site into a 46-apartment complex for the over 55’s, complete with community facilities, gardens and restored mill dam. The scheme has been designed with the lifestyle and well-being of its residents in mind.  Set in a courtyard style, the apartments will be centred around a landscaped garden and overlook the restored landscaped mill dam. In addition there will be a residents’ pavilion, house manager, guest bedrooms, and an area set aside for the residents to do their own gardening, such as herbs, flowers or even vegetables!

  

Conroy Brook Chief Executive, Richard Conroy said: “We have an ageing population, with the number of retired persons set to more than double within 25 years, and this trend is reflected in Kirklees. Many people have talked to me of the difficulty of finding suitable retirement homes in the Holme Valley, which is why we are delighted to receive planning approval, to allow us to bring this scheme forward.

 

We have a track record of award winning retirement developments and believe the Prickleden Mill site will make a positive contribution to the community, including an estimated 350 construction jobs, and deliver much needed, modern retirement units. We have also already had an astounding level of interest, with over 80 people registering to receive more information.”

 

Conroy Brook is confident that this new development will respect the heritage of the site, whilst providing residents with modern accommodation of the highest quality within walking distance of the heart of Holmfirth.

 

It is envisaged that work on the site will start in 2013.
